OK guys, I said I would do it, and there seemed to be considerable interest, so here it is:
 
Download ALL the bots!
 
^ That's my entire stock Robot Designs folder, minus any bots that weren't built by me or FB and any bots with custom parts.  The bots date back to 2003 when we first got the game, up to now.  At least half of them were never showcased so there's plenty of old content to poke through.
 
The .bot files all conveniently start with "CB_" or "FB_" depending on who built it, so they don't get mixed up with your own bots.  Except for Lots OOOOOOOO wheels which was built by FB's friend.
 
...Looking back, I kinda miss building bots like Evil Weevil V and Gigawhirl II and Double Edge.  I had kind of an IRL style before I found the forums.

Uhh, do any of these bots use custom components? Bumblebee (wedge thing) accidentally my game.

I took out all the bots I know have custom components.  Bumblebee should be stock, unless it was modified with custom parts at some later time.  I'll have to check once I get access to RA2 again.
 
In case you were wondering, Bumblebee is a harmless-looking wedge with hidden weapons (a popup spike and a flamethrower) that FB made before either of us had ever seen a popup.  It's sort of like a proto-popup.
